Haleakala National Park bird survey data 1993-2008 Haleakala National Park bird survey data 1993-2008
Eight-minute point-transect distance bird surveys were collected in and around Haleakala National Park from 1993-2008. This dataset contains the location, species, and distance to detected birds, as well as identifying initials to distinguish among observers.
Hawaii Island Kohala Mountain complex forest bird survey, 2017 Hawaii Island Kohala Mountain complex forest bird survey, 2017
This data release contains the point-transect distance sampling records of forest bird survey collected in the Kohala Mountain complex in 2017, including survey point IDs, distance to detected birds, sampling conditions, ohia phenology, habitat classifications and background noise levels. This data release consists of one tabular dataset.

Airborne Electromagnetic and Magnetic Survey, Yellowstone National Park, 2016 - Minimally Processed Data Airborne Electromagnetic and Magnetic Survey, Yellowstone National Park, 2016 - Minimally Processed Data
Airborne electromagnetic (AEM) and magnetic survey data were collected during November and December 2016 along 4,212 line-kilometers over Yellowstone National Park, Wyoming. The survey was conducted as part of a study of the subsurface geologic structure and geothermal and groundwater resources of Yellowstone National Park. Massachusetts Shoreline Change Project, 2021 Update: A GIS Compilation of Shoreline Change Rates Calculated Using Digital Shoreline Analysis System Version 5.1, With Supplementary Intersects and Baselines for Massachusetts Massachusetts Shoreline Change Project, 2021 Update: A GIS Compilation of Shoreline Change Rates Calculated Using Digital Shoreline Analysis System Version 5.1, With Supplementary Intersects and Baselines for Massachusetts
The Massachusetts Office of Coastal Zone Management launched the Shoreline Change Project in 1989 to identify erosion-prone areas of the coast and support local land-use decisions. Trends of shoreline position over long and short-term timescales provide information to landowners, managers, and potential buyers about possible future impacts to coastal resources and infrastructure.
